Calibration file = Q:\Cruise_Data\2005-21\CTD data\doc\2005-21-recal2.ccf Calibrations applied: Ch Name Units Fmla Coefficents -- ----------------------------- --------- --- ----------------------------- 10 Oxygen:Dissolved:SBE [mL/L] mL/L 10 -0.1200000E+00 0.1000000E+01 -REMOVECH 2005/10/25 13:06:11 The following CHANNEL(S) were removed: Scan_Number Temperature:Secondary [deg C (ITS90)] Conductivity:Primary [S/m] Conductivity:Secondary [S/m] Oxygen:Voltage:SBE [volts] Oxygen:Dissolved:SBE [umol/kg] Altimeter [metres] Status:Pump Descent_Rate [m/s] Salinity:T1:C1 [PSS-78] Flag -CLEAN functions: 2005/10/25 13:07:25 20 Insert Pad Values in Channel: Oxygen:Dissolved:SBE [mL/L] where channel Pressure [dbars] is in the range 1300 to 10000 9063 data records in pad range. -CHANGE units: 'Oxygen:Dissolved:SBE' changed from mL/L to umol/kg -HEADER EDITS: 2005/10/25 13:11:21 Applied edit header: Q:\Cruise_Data\2005-21\CTD data\doc\2005-21-hdr.txt Channel 1: Pressure [decibar] Units: dbars ==> decibar Format: F10.3 ==> F7.1 Channel 4: Fluorescence:URU:Seapoint [mg/m^3] Name: Fluorescence:Seapoint ==> Fluorescence:URU:Seapoint Channel 5: Oxygen:Dissolved:SBE [mL/L] Format: F8.3 ==> F7.2 $END *COMMENTS SBE HEADER Sea-Bird SBE 9 Data File: FileName = C:\DATA\2005-21\2005-21-0031.dat Software Version Seasave Win32 V 5.35 Temperature SN = 4484 Conductivity SN = 3038 Number of Bytes Per Scan = 30 Number of Voltage Words = 4 Number of Scans Averaged by the Deck Unit = 1 System UpLoad Time = Aug 20 2005 04:34:54 NMEA Latitude = 49 11.98 N NMEA Longitude = 133 39.87 W NMEA UTC (Time) = Aug 20 2005 04:34:39 Store Lat/Lon Data = Add to Header Only Ship:Tully Cruise:2005-21 Station: P15 Latitude: 49 11.99 Longitude: 133 39.90 Depth: 3388 # nquan = 17 # nvalues = 76556 # units = specified # name 0 = scan: Scan Count # name 1 = prDM: Pressure, Digiquartz [db] # name 2 = t090C: Temperature [ITS-90, deg C] # name 3 = t190C: Temperature, 2 [ITS-90, deg C] # name 4 = c0S/m: Conductivity [S/m] # name 5 = c1S/m: Conductivity, 2 [S/m] # name 6 = xmiss: Beam Transmission, Chelsea/Seatech/Wetlab CStar [%] # name 7 = flSP: Fluorescence, Seapoint # name 8 = sbeox0V: Oxygen Voltage, SBE 43 # name 9 = sbeox0ML/L: Oxygen, SBE 43 [ml/l] # name 10 = sbeox0Mm/Kg: Oxygen, SBE 43 [umol/Kg] # name 11 = altM: Altimeter [m] # name 12 = pumps: Pump Status # name 13 = dz/dtM: Descent Rate [m/s] # name 14 = sal00: Salinity [PSU] # name 15 = sal11: Salinity, 2 [PSU] # name 16 = flag: flag # span 0 = 1, 76556 # span 1 = 0.374, 2005.719 # span 2 = 1.9396, 16.6689 # span 3 = 1.9387, 16.6684 # span 4 = 3.096027, 4.138503 # span 5 = 3.125727, 4.138629 # span 6 = 81.7821, 89.4493 # span 7 = 3.6630e-02, 3.4103e+00 # span 8 = 0.5665, 2.4652 # span 9 = 0.18928, 4.99052 # span 10 = 8.228, 217.418 # span 11 = 0.00, 100.00 # span 12 = 0, 1 # span 13 = -1.947, 1.814 # span 14 = 23.5122, 34.5891 # span 15 = 25.0204, 34.5915 # span 16 = 0.0000e+00, 0.0000e+00 # interval = seconds: 0.0416667 # start_time = Aug 20 2005 04:34:54 # bad_flag = -9.990e-29 # sensor 0 = Frequency 0 temperature, primary, 4484, 19-Mar-05 # sensor 1 = Frequency 1 conductivity, primary, 3038, 03-Mar-05, cpcor = -9.57 00e-08 # sensor 2 = Frequency 2 pressure, 63507, 25-Oct-04 # sensor 3 = Frequency 3 temperature, secondary, 2106, 08-Jul-05 # sensor 4 = Frequency 4 conductivity, secondary, 1729, 12-Jul-05, cpcor = -9. 5700e-08 # sensor 5 = Extrnl Volt 0 Fluorometer, Seapoint, primary # sensor 6 = Extrnl Volt 2 transmissometer, primary, 732DR, 22-May-05 # sensor 7 = Extrnl Volt 4 Oxygen, SBE, primary, 0766, 16-Nov-04p # sensor 8 = Extrnl Volt 6 altimeter # datcnv_date = Oct 12 2005 13:29:50, 5.32a # datcnv_in = Q:\Cruise_Data\2005-21\CTD data\2005-21-0031.dat Q:\Cruise_Data\20 05-21\CTD data\2005-21-0001.CON # datcnv_skipover = 0 # wildedit_date = Oct 12 2005 15:44:34, 5.32a # wildedit_in = Q:\Cruise_Data\2005-21\CTD data\convert\2005-21-0031.cnv # wildedit_pass1_nstd = 2.0 # wildedit_pass2_nstd = 20.0 # wildedit_pass2_mindelta = 0.000e+000 # wildedit_npoint = 25 # wildedit_vars = prDM t090C t190C # wildedit_excl_bad_scans = yes # celltm_date = Oct 12 2005 16:46:30, 5.32a # celltm_in = Q:\Cruise_Data\2005-21\CTD data\wildedit\2005-21-0031.cnv # celltm_alpha = 0.0200, 0.0300 # celltm_tau = 9.0000, 9.0000 # celltm_temp_sensor_use_for_cond = primary, secondary # Derive_date = Oct 12 2005 17:35:39, 5.32a # Derive_in = Q:\Cruise_Data\2005-21\CTD data\celltm\2005-21-0031.cnv Q:\Cruise_ Data\2004-13\CTD\2004-13-ctd2.con # file_type = ascii END* CTDEDIT was used to remove records from the top 2.2db; salinity was cleaned lightly. Transmissivity and fluorescence are nominal and unedited except that some records were removed in editing temperature and salinity. The SBE dissolved oxygen data in the CTD files should be considered • ±0.6ml/l from 0 - 150m • ±0.4ml/l from 150 – 300m • ±0.2ml/l from 300 - 1300m • data was removed from 1300m down since it is considered unreliable there. *CALIBRATION $TABLE: CORRECTED CHANNELS !
